About Peng Chen

Peng Chen is a scholar working on Soil Science, Water Science and Technology,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Aquatic Science and Plant Science, having authored 210 papers that have together received 2.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Soil Carbon and Nitrogen Dynamics (31 papers), Rice Cultivation and Yield Improvement (19 papers), Irrigation Practices and Water Management (12 papers),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(11 papers), Minerals Flotation and Separation Techniques (11 papers),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(10 papers),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(8 papers) and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Soil Science (375 citations), Water Science and Technology (375 citations), Plant Science (763 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(172 citations) and Pollution (213 citations). Peng Chen has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Zhongxue Zhang, Tangzhe Nie, Tiecheng Li, Qizhi Liu, Junzeng Xu, Weihua Li, Zhijuan Qi, Yina Liu, Kaiyi Shi and Yu Li. Their work appears in journals such as Agronomy, Agricultural Water Management, Plants, Minerals Engineering and CATENA.
